/external/llvm/lib/CodeGen/ |
CalcSpillWeights.cpp | 41 VRAI.calculateSpillWeightAndHint(LIS.getInterval(Reg)); 113 const LiveInterval &SrcLI = LIS.getInterval(Reg);
|
SplitKit.cpp | 317 const LiveInterval &Orig = LIS.getInterval(OrigReg); 390 LiveInterval *LI = &LIS.getInterval(Edit->get(RegIdx)); 435 LiveInterval *LI = &LIS.getInterval(Edit->get(RegIdx)); 448 LiveInterval *LI = &LIS.getInterval(Edit->get(RegIdx)); 456 LiveInterval &OrigLI = LIS.getInterval(Original); 651 LiveInterval *LI = &LIS.getInterval(Edit->get(0)); 748 LiveInterval *LI = &LIS.getInterval(Edit->get(0)); 803 LiveInterval *LI = &LIS.getInterval(Edit->get(0)); [all...] |
RegAllocPBQP.cpp | 172 LIS.getInterval(G.getNodeMetadata(NId).getVReg()).weight; 306 LiveInterval &LI = LIS.getInterval(VReg); 539 LiveInterval &LI = LIS.getInterval(Reg); 577 LiveInterval &VRegLI = LIS.getInterval(VReg); 641 LiveRangeEdit LRE(&LIS.getInterval(VReg), NewIntervals, MF, LIS, &VRM, 654 const LiveInterval &LI = LIS.getInterval(*I); 711 LiveInterval &LI = LIS.getInterval(*I);
|
PHIElimination.cpp | 328 LiveInterval &DestLI = LIS->getInterval(DestReg); 470 LiveInterval &SrcLI = LIS->getInterval(SrcReg); 629 return LIS->isLiveInToMBB(LIS->getInterval(Reg), MBB); 644 const LiveInterval &LI = LIS->getInterval(Reg);
|
VirtRegMap.cpp | 294 LiveInterval &LI = LIS->getInterval(VirtReg); 333 const LiveInterval &LI = LIS->getInterval(Reg);
|
TwoAddressInstructionPass.cpp | 224 LiveInterval &LI = LIS->getInterval(SavedReg); 410 LiveInterval &LI = LIS->getInterval(Reg); 832 LiveInterval &LI = LIS->getInterval(Reg); [all...] |
/external/llvm/lib/Target/WebAssembly/ |
WebAssemblyStoreResults.cpp | 85 LiveInterval *FromLI = &LIS.getInterval(FromReg); 86 LiveInterval *ToLI = &LIS.getInterval(ToReg);
|
WebAssemblyRegStackify.cpp | 236 if (const VNInfo *ValNo = LIS.getInterval(Reg).getVNInfoBefore( 254 const LiveInterval &LI = LIS.getInterval(Reg); 310 const LiveInterval &LI = LIS.getInterval(Reg); 358 const LiveInterval &LI = LIS.getInterval(Reg); 460 LiveInterval &LI = LIS.getInterval(Reg); 498 LiveInterval &LI = LIS.getInterval(Reg); 561 LiveInterval &LI = LIS.getInterval(Reg); [all...] |
WebAssemblyRegColoring.cpp | 106 LiveInterval *LI = &Liveness->getInterval(VReg);
|
/external/swiftshader/third_party/llvm-7.0/llvm/lib/CodeGen/ |
RegAllocBasic.cpp | 146 LiveInterval &LI = LIS->getInterval(VirtReg); 165 LiveInterval &LI = LIS->getInterval(VirtReg);
|
SplitKit.cpp | 343 const LiveInterval &Orig = LIS.getInterval(OrigReg); 464 LiveInterval *LI = &LIS.getInterval(Edit->get(RegIdx)); 507 addDeadDef(LIS.getInterval(Edit->get(RegIdx)), VNI, false); 553 LiveInterval &DestLI = LIS.getInterval(Edit->get(RegIdx)); 633 LiveInterval *LI = &LIS.getInterval(Edit->get(RegIdx)); 641 LiveInterval &OrigLI = LIS.getInterval(Original); 848 LiveInterval *LI = &LIS.getInterval(Edit->get(0)); [all...] |
RegAllocPBQP.cpp | 203 LIS.getInterval(G.getNodeMetadata(NId).getVReg()).weight; 336 LiveInterval &LI = LIS.getInterval(VReg); 595 LiveInterval &VRegLI = LIS.getInterval(VReg); 653 if (LIS.getInterval(VReg).empty()) { 682 LiveRangeEdit LRE(&LIS.getInterval(VReg), NewIntervals, MF, LIS, &VRM, 695 const LiveInterval &LI = LIS.getInterval(*I); 752 LiveInterval &LI = LIS.getInterval(*I); [all...] |
RegisterCoalescer.cpp | 511 LIS->getInterval(CP.isFlipped() ? CP.getDstReg() : CP.getSrcReg()); 513 LIS->getInterval(CP.isFlipped() ? CP.getSrcReg() : CP.getDstReg()); 679 LIS->getInterval(CP.isFlipped() ? CP.getDstReg() : CP.getSrcReg()); 681 LIS->getInterval(CP.isFlipped() ? CP.getSrcReg() : CP.getDstReg()); [all...] |
PHIElimination.cpp | 342 LiveInterval &DestLI = LIS->getInterval(DestReg); 484 LiveInterval &SrcLI = LIS->getInterval(SrcReg); 644 return LIS->isLiveInToMBB(LIS->getInterval(Reg), MBB); 659 const LiveInterval &LI = LIS->getInterval(Reg);
|
CalcSpillWeights.cpp | 47 VRAI.calculateSpillWeightAndHint(LIS.getInterval(Reg)); 130 const LiveInterval &SrcLI = LIS.getInterval(Reg);
|
RegAllocGreedy.cpp | 634 LiveInterval &LI = LIS->getInterval(VirtReg); 653 LiveInterval &LI = LIS->getInterval(VirtReg); 749 LiveInterval *LI = &LIS->getInterval(~CurQueue.top().second); [all...] |
/external/swiftshader/third_party/LLVM/lib/CodeGen/ |
RegAllocPBQP.cpp | 222 const LiveInterval *vregLI = &lis->getInterval(vreg); 240 const LiveInterval *pregLI = &lis->getInterval(preg); 288 const LiveInterval &l1 = lis->getInterval(vr1); 294 const LiveInterval &l2 = lis->getInterval(vr2); 510 LiveInterval &rhsInterval = lis->getInterval(spilled->reg); 538 const LiveInterval* spillInterval = &lis->getInterval(vreg); 581 LiveInterval *li = &lis->getInterval(*itr);
|
LiveRangeEdit.cpp | 101 LiveInterval &li = lis.getInterval(MO.getReg()); 249 LiveInterval &LI = LIS.getInterval(Reg);
|
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Target/WebAssembly/ |
WebAssemblyRegColoring.cpp | 109 LiveInterval *LI = &Liveness->getInterval(VReg);
|
WebAssemblyRegStackify.cpp | 273 if (const VNInfo *ValNo = LIS.getInterval(Reg).getVNInfoBefore( 291 const LiveInterval &LI = LIS.getInterval(Reg); 391 const LiveInterval &LI = LIS.getInterval(Reg); 495 LiveInterval &LI = LIS.getInterval(Reg); 533 LiveInterval &LI = LIS.getInterval(Reg); 596 LiveInterval &LI = LIS.getInterval(Reg); [all...] |
/external/swiftshader/third_party/LLVM/include/llvm/CodeGen/ |
LiveIntervalAnalysis.h | 86 LiveInterval &getInterval(unsigned reg) { 92 const LiveInterval &getInterval(unsigned reg) const {
|
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Target/SystemZ/ |
SystemZRegisterInfo.cpp | 268 LiveInterval &IntGR128 = LIS.getInterval(GR128Reg); 269 LiveInterval &IntGRNar = LIS.getInterval(GRNarReg);
|
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Target/AMDGPU/ |
GCNRegPressure.cpp | 47 const auto &LI = LIS.getInterval(Reg); 258 const auto &LI = LIS.getInterval(Reg); 377 const LiveInterval &LI = LIS.getInterval(It.first);
|
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Target/Hexagon/ |
HexagonExpandCondsets.cpp | 334 LiveInterval &LI = LIS->getInterval(Reg); 426 LiveInterval &LI = LIS->getInterval(Reg); 528 LiveInterval &LI = LIS->getInterval(Reg); 572 LIS->getInterval(R).verify(); [all...] |
/external/llvm/lib/Target/Hexagon/ |
HexagonExpandCondsets.cpp | 363 LiveInterval &LI = LIS->getInterval(Reg); 528 LiveInterval &LI = LIS->getInterval(Reg); 570 LIS->getInterval(R).verify(); [all...] |